#719497 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#719497 is composed of 44.3% red, 58%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.2% cyan, 2%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 184.7 degrees, a saturation of 15.4% and a lightness of 51.8%. #719497 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#00292f.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#719497 color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an.
#719497 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#719497 has RGB values of R:113, G:148,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 7443607.

Shades and Tints of #719497
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040505 is the darkest color, while #f9faf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#719497
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848484 is the less saturated color, while #12e4f6 is the most saturated one.
